How Group Admins Submit an Employee Timesheet

Overview

Group Administrators can submit timesheets on behalf of staff assigned to their group β€” including timesheets that cover future dates. Regular employees (non-admin users) do not have this capability and must submit their own timesheets through their personal accounts.

Before You Begin

  • You must be assigned as a Group Administrator in the Time Attendance module.
  • The staff member must belong to your assigned group.
  • The date range selected must be within a single month (31 days maximum).
  • At least one Approving Officer must be configured in the approval workflow.

Steps to Submit an Employee Timesheet

  1. Log in to your JustLogin account.
  2. Click on Apps menu icon and navigate to the Time Attendance section section.
  3. On the Administration page, click the Timesheet tab tab.
  4. Select the staff member's name from the drop-down list.
    Staff name drop-down list
  5. Choose a preset period or set a custom date range.
    Period or custom date selection

     

    Note: The selected date range must be within a single calendar month β€” a maximum of 31 days. Future dates are supported.

  6. Select the Approving Officer from the drop-down.
    Approving Officer field

     

    Note: If your organisation uses a two-level approval workflow, a Processing Officer field will also appear. The Processing Officer acts as the final approver once the Approving Officer has approved the timesheet.

     

    Processing Officer field for two-level approval

  7. Click Search or Generate button to load the timesheet data.
  8. Review the staff member's Clock In and Clock Out records, along with the assigned Shift Name.
    Timesheet data with clock in and clock out records

     

    Note: You may edit the following fields before submitting:

    • Shift Name β€” Changing this will automatically recalculate the Work Time.
    • Clock In / Clock Out times
    • Remarks β€” Add any relevant notes for the approver.

     

  9. Once you have reviewed and finalised all entries, click Submit button to submit the timesheet.

What Happens After Submission

Once submitted, the timesheet follows the configured approval workflow:

  1. The Approving Officer receives a notification to review and approve the timesheet.
  2. If a two-level approval is configured, the Processing Officer will receive it next for final approval.

Summary Table

FeatureGroup AdminRegular Employee
Submit own timesheetYesYes
Submit timesheet on behalf of othersYesNo
Submit timesheet with future datesYesNo
Edit shift, clock in/out, and remarks before submissionYesNo
